Qben Infra är en koncern specialiserad på förvärv och utveckling av plattformar inom infrastrukturtjänster i Norden. Bolaget har en diversifierad portfölj av företag över infrastrukturnischerna: Construction, Rail, Power and Testing, Inspection & Certification. Fokusen är på att identifiera investeringsmöjligheter inom nischer med potential för utveckling, konsolidering och tillväxt. Qben Infra grundades 2001 och har sitt huvudkontor i Hägersten.

Laje AS, a subsidiary of Qben Infra-owned Qben Power, has been awarded a contract SEK 94 million in Sweden.

Laje AS, a subsidiary of Qben Infra-owned Qben Power, has been awarded a contract by Ellevio AB for the construction of a 170 kV power line between Tandö and Nyhusen, Sweden. The power line will stretch approximately 31 kilometers and include around 192 pole positions, with four steel poles and the rest made of wood. The contract is valued at SEK 94 million and is expected to be completed by January 31, 2027. “This contract win is a testament to our ongoing efforts to strengthen our presence in the Swedish market” says Anders Granshagen, CEO Qben Power.

About Qben Infra

Qben Infra invests in and develops companies in infrastructure services in the Nordic region. The company operates in niches where the market is driven by strong growth trends, large government investments and where opportunities for consolidation and strong growth exist - for example, railways and power grids. The strategy includes driving organic growth, reinforced by selective acquisitions (M&A) and realisation of synergies. For more information, see qben.se.
